Making the 30-minute trip from home to The Supreme Ice Cream Shoppe is so worthwhile especially when it's halo-halo I am craving for. I have been going and having their halo-halo for many years! I have tasted halo-halo from other places, but nothing compares to theirs especially for the price they're selling it for. Definitely more value to your dollars. My husband and daughter like their home made ice cream, too. I have suggested this place to my friends and they only have positive feedback once they have tried their halo-halo. It's also convenient that they offer other varieties of food. So if you're looking for something savory (and warm) to pair with your halo-halo, they have several dishes to choose from. So far the ones I've tried were good. This place is a definite go-to for their halo-halo and would strongly recommend this to everyone.

One of Winnipeg's hidden gems and hand's down the best place to go for desserts here in Winnipeg. I like them specifically for their ice cream. I got the mango and pistachio, served on a waffle cone and the best part is that it’s made with REAL FRUITS and not artificial flavouring!!! I’ve tried their drinks like the buko pandan and they are pretty good too. There are also a myriad of other Filipino food options. My personal favourite is the spaghetti with garlic toast bread, siopao and LUGAW!! (perfect for when you get sick). Definitely stop by here if you are craving for something cold during the hot summer days, or want to try some hearty filipino food delicacies.

More than an ice cream shop in Jefferson Street. Open from 10:30am to 9pm (except Sunday 8pm). They have different kinds of desserts or snacks. Halohalo (Mixed-with crushed ice, flan, ube jam, ube ice cream, banana, beans, tapioca pearls, and many more) from special regular size to Big Daddy size. Taho (Soft Tofu)- tofu with sweetener and tapioca pearls. They also have cakes, spring roll, spaghetti, siomai, kutsinta, siopao, and more. Wheelchair accessible and shared parking area

Went there and got their bubble tea. There were around 3 or 4 other flavours that were out before I just accepted going with Strawberry. The flavour was too sweet and I didn't taste strawberry at all. My husband got a sundae only to find out that they ran out of vanilla ice cream.

Around 7:30, it started slowing down and and a guy started rearranging the tables and chairs. The table surfaces were still covered in ice cream and other sticky substances.

On their website, it says that they are open until 9pm. So at 8pm, the guy announced to the whole store "okay we are close now. Good bye everybody."
